Description

Huiros are important to the indigenous music of the Andes & are traditional Percussion instruments from the Andes. They have a rich pre-Colombian tradition. Huiros have parallel crevices along the top which are scratched back & forth with a metal fork or wood stick to make a rhythm. The gourd is hollowed out & carved with an Andean scene. There are two holes to be able to hold the huiro with finger & thumb while being played.
